Enable DWA r8.02 lite Mode

The IBM Lotus Domino Web Access lite mode enables users to quickly access emails, contacts, and day-at-a-glance calendars. These client performance improvements use Web 2.0 technology (such as Ajax) and surpass 6.5.3 fix pack1 for the performance improvements that Lotus Domino Web Access brings.

 

Lotus Domino Web Access lite mode supports the browsers and platforms used in the Lotus Domino Web Access full mode. The Lotus Domino Web Access lite mode is fully integrated into the Lotus Domino 8 mail template and forms8.nsf. Therefore, as long as the Lotus Domino Web Access user upgrades the Lotus Domino Server and mail template to version 8.0.1, you can use the lite mode.

 

Lotus Domino Web Access performs very well in high-speed networks or browsers that can use the previous Lotus Domino Web Access session. However, when users try to use Lotus Domino Web Access in a low-bandwidth environment, they are often disappointed with client performance. In fact, we found that some users still use the old Lotus Domino webmail product in these environments (simpler web 1.0 HTML solution earlier than iNotes/Lotus Domino Web Access ).

 

Lotus Domino Web Access lite mode is provided by default by Lotus Domino 8.0.1. You can switch to Lite mode in several ways:

1. If you are using Lotus Domino Web Access redirect with a logon form mapped to dwaloginform, you can select this mode on the logon page (for example ).

 

The shared or public computer option on the logon page is also a new feature of 8.0.1. This feature supports full mode and lite mode. When this feature is enabled, it can pass the & RA = 0 parameter after calling Lotus Domino Web Access to prevent users from accessing attachments. For more information about this option, see IBM support expert te #1297042 "What is the purpose of the 'shared or public compute' option on the Domino Web Access login form ?".

 

2. Another way to access lite mode is to use the switch in the user interface of Lotus Domino Web Access full mode, as shown in.

 

You can use the inotes_wa_enablelitemode = 0 notes. ini parameter to hide the mode switch. This option is useful if you do not want users to use lite mode.

 

3. The administrator can also use the inotes_wa_defaultui = dwa_lite notes. ini parameter to set the Lotus Domino Web Access lite mode to the default mode for all Lotus Domino Web Access Users. When this parameter is used, the mail database accessed with an explicit URL (such as the http://yourserver.yourdomain.com/mail/tuser.nsf) will start in lite mode. However, in 8.0.1, if Lotus Domino Web Access redirect is used, the logon mode is used, regardless of the notes. ini setting. For more information, see Notes #1297981 "Domino Web Access redirect overrides the default mode set using the 'inotes _ wa_defaultui 'notes. ini parameter ".

 

4. The new url ui parameter & UI = dwa_lite can trigger Lotus Domino Web Access to open lite mode. It can also match? Use the opendatabase Domino URL Command together:
Http://yourserver.yourdomain.com/mail/tuser.nsf? Opendatabase & UI = dwa_lite
